Felix F. Rondeau
Inducted: 1979
In the 1940s, Felix F. Rondeau played a major role in the
consolidation of five cooperative insurance companies, which were to become Mutual
Service Insurance Companies. He was general manager of the consolidated insurance
program and was the first president of Mutual Services from 1951 until his early
retirement in 1970. After retirement from MSI, he became an incorporator and charter
board member of a new cooperative leasing organization, and was chosen its first
president and general manager. He was active in national and international cooperative
work, and for many years represented U.S. co-ops in the Central Committee of the
International Cooperative Alliance.
